導航:首頁 > 文件目錄 > 分布式文件系統和分布式資料庫

分布式文件系統和分布式資料庫

發布時間:2025-02-08 09:51:04

㈠ 雲計算的六大組成部分分別是什麼

雲計算的六大組成部分分別是什麼?

雲計算的六大組成部分分別是:虛擬化、自動化部署、應用規模擴展、分布式文件系統、分布式資料庫與非結構化數據存儲、分布式計算。

虛擬化可大幅度提高組織過程中資源和應用程序的效率和可用性。

雲計算的一個核心思想是通過自動化的方式盡可能地簡化任務,使得用戶可以通過自助服務方式快捷地獲取所需的資源和能力。

雲計算提供了一個巨大的資源池,而應用的使用又有不同的負載周期,根據負載對應用的資源進行動態伸縮可以顯著提高資源的有效利用率。

分布式存儲的目標是利用雲環境中多台伺服器的存儲資源來滿足單台伺服器所不能滿足的存儲需求。

在分布式文件系統上。典型的存儲海量結構化數據的分布式存儲系統包括Google的BigTable、開源的HBase等。

大數據用什麼架構

大數據的架構主要包括分布式文件系統、NoSQL資料庫、列式資料庫、雲計算平台等。


一、分布式文件系統


大數據的存儲和管理依賴於分布式文件系統。這類架構將文件分散存儲在多個伺服器上,利用多台伺服器共同處理數據,實現數據的分布式存儲和處理。這種架構可以有效地提高數據存儲的可靠性和數據處理的速度。


二、NoSQL資料庫


對於大數據的處理,NoSQL資料庫是一個重要的組成部分。與傳統的關系型資料庫不同,NoSQL資料庫更適合處理大量、非結構化的數據。這種資料庫架構具有可擴展性強、靈活性強、讀寫性能高等特點,可以很好地滿足大數據處理的需求。


三、列式資料庫


列式資料庫是大數據架構中另一種重要的數據存儲方式。它與傳統的關系型資料庫的行式存儲不同,列式存儲可以更好地滿足大數據分析的需求。列式資料庫針對列進行存儲和處理,可以大大提高大數據查詢和分析的效率。


四、雲計算平台


雲計算平台是大數據架構的重要支撐。雲計算平台可以提供彈性的計算資源,根據大數據處理的需求動態地分配計算資源。同時,雲計算平台還可以提供數據的安全存儲、備份和恢復等功能,保障大數據的安全性和可靠性。


綜上所述,大數據的架構包括分布式文件系統、NoSQL資料庫、列式資料庫以及雲計算平台等。這些架構共同協作,實現了大數據的高效存儲、處理和查詢,滿足了大數據時代對數據處理的巨大需求。

閱讀全文

與分布式文件系統和分布式資料庫相關的資料

熱點內容
上海房主發布租房哪個網站好 瀏覽:311
郊區用什麼網路 瀏覽:269
樂寫app如何發作品屏蔽人 瀏覽:584
linux中文件壓縮與打包 瀏覽:34
拷貝文件夾到指定目錄 瀏覽:103
win10打不來金橙子軟體下載 瀏覽:789
virtuagirlhd安卓版 瀏覽:39
word上面插入pdf文件 瀏覽:568
javac內存管理 瀏覽:532
秒剪APP怎麼剪掉不要的部分 瀏覽:416
宜賓有什麼拆遷文件 瀏覽:811
linuxterminator使用 瀏覽:551
ai啟動配置文件 瀏覽:664
汽車故障診斷數據採集有什麼用 瀏覽:594
手機對手機傳文件最快 瀏覽:103
文件預覽窗格圖片怎麼放大 瀏覽:699
自動編程適用於哪些情況 瀏覽:686
樂高編程課是學什麼的幼兒園 瀏覽:880
照片刪除了在哪個文件夾 瀏覽:513
電腦怎麼把文件圖片變大 瀏覽:565

友情鏈接